GeForce GTX 1050 Max Q is a Laptop Graphics Card

Note: GeForce GTX 1050 Max Q is only used in laptop graphics. It has lower GPU clock speed compared to the desktop variant, which results in lower power consumption, but also 10-30% lower gaming performance. Check available laptop models with GeForce GTX 1050 Max Q here:

  • GeForce GTX 1050 Max Q has 17% more power consumption, than Radeon HD 5670.
  • GeForce GTX 1050 Max Q is connected by PCIe 3.0 x16, and Radeon HD 5670 uses PCIe 2.0 x16 interface.
  • GeForce GTX 1050 Max Q has 3 GB more memory, than Radeon HD 5670.
  • GeForce GTX 1050 Max Q is used in Laptops, and Radeon HD 5670 - in Desktops.
  • GeForce GTX 1050 Max Q is build with Pascal architecture, and Radeon HD 5670 - with Terascale 2.
  • Core clock speed of GeForce GTX 1050 Max Q is 224 MHz higher, than Radeon HD 5670.
  • GeForce GTX 1050 Max Q is manufactured by 14 nm process technology, and Radeon HD 5670 - by 40 nm process technology.
  • Memory clock speed of GeForce GTX 1050 Max Q is 6000 MHz higher, than Radeon HD 5670.
